What to Look for in a Gaming Laptop in 2025
When comparing gaming laptops, consider:
- GPU performance (RTX series recommended)
- High refresh rate display (144Hz or more)
- Good cooling system
- 16GB RAM minimum
- SSD storage for speed
Performance isn’t just about FPS — it’s also about long-term value, thermals, and upgradeability.
